The cheapest way to get from Westmead to Mascot is to drive which costs $5 - $8 and takes 23 min.
The fastest way to get from Westmead to Mascot is to taxi which takes 23 min and costs $80 - $100.
No, there is no direct train from Westmead station to Mascot station. However, there are services departing from Westmead Station and arriving at Mascot Station via Central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 43 min.
The distance between Westmead and Mascot is 30 km. The road distance is 28.2 km.
The best way to get from Westmead to Mascot without a car is to train which takes 43 min and costs $5 - $9.
It takes approximately 43 min to get from Westmead to Mascot, including transfers.
Westmead to Mascot train services, operated by Sydney Trains, depart from Westmead Station.
Westmead to Mascot train services, operated by Sydney Trains, arrive at Central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Westmead to Mascot is 28 km. It takes approximately 23 min to drive from Westmead to Mascot.
